Modbus is a legacy protocol designed for reliability, not security. It lacks native authentication. The W3000 implementation historically allowed a connected client to write to Holding Registers (Function Code 06 or 16) without restriction.

While the patch mitigates the risk of immediate unauthorized parameter changes, significant risks remain for legacy deployments and environments where default configurations persist.

If you are writing an academic paper on “security patching of HVAC protocols,” you must use a test bench with isolated hardware, manufacturer consent, and clearly state that unauthorized modifications are not for field deployment.

A "patched" register list often expands upon the basic read-only status codes to include writable setpoints and system overrides. Register Type Address (Typical) Digital Input On/Off Status Active Setpoint Holding Register Chilled Water Setpoint Inlet Water Temp Input Register Real-time Temperature Alarm Reset Remote Alarm Reset Demand Limit Holding Register Power Consumption Limit ⚠️ Security and Safety Warnings

and specific supervisor parameters (typically 9600 or 19200 baud). Security & Troubleshooting : Technical manuals suggest that common Modbus errors

Ensure your Climaveneta W3000 unit has the latest firmware installed. Sometimes, updates include patches for communication protocols like Modbus.

Are you using a (like Intesis or Babelbuster)?

Please wait downloading ...

Please wait detecting ...

We have sent an email to your email.
Please check your email, follow the instructions to verify your email address.